Lincolnshire and the Flatlands
Season 1Episode 930 min

Lincolnshire and the Flatlands

James flies over the fertile plains of Lincolnshire and the flatlands to explore why it is an area so famed for its world-class pork and how it has the ideal environment for the mass production of perfect peas. On his journey he cooks succulent Lincolnshire pork chops with a scrumpy apple sauce and crispy cabbage, and steamed fillet of plaice with pea purée, steamed peas in their pods, asparagus and crispy bacon.
